The SBU’s performance of the fake murder of fugitive liberal Arkady Babchenko worked against the current ruling regime - official Kyiv has forever lost its authority in the eyes of the West.
Political scientist Ruslan Bortnik stated this on air on the 112 Ukraine TV channel, a PolitNavigator correspondent reports.

“We can say with confidence that the PR campaign was unsuccessful. This is a case that could be used for Ukraine as an element of influence on Russia and to further discredit it, but due to the use of our Western partners “in the dark,” it seems to me that this whole situation to some extent led to the opposite effect , to a certain level of mistrust in society,” he noted.
Bortnik noted that a special blow was dealt to the head of the Ukrainian Foreign Ministry, Pavel Klimkin, who announced the death of Babchenko at the UN Security Council.
"As a diplomat, he ( Klimkin, author's note ) deceived other diplomats; he lost his diplomatic credibility in the world. Even Israel doesn't resort to such special operations. Several Israeli channels I work with say they have no such precedents.
They simply caused unnecessary mistrust...
Now each of our new situations, each of our new shouts: “Wolves, wolves!” – Russia will provide information to the world through the prism of the situation with Babchenko.
The inhibition that will arise in response to some crises in Ukraine on the part of Western partners, the distrust and skepticism that they will now be deceived, and that this will result in another “special operation” of our law enforcement agencies, will haunt us for some time,” Bortnik said .
